Volleyball Preview: Oldham County Colonels vs. North Oldham Mustangs
Oldham County is on a six-game streak of home wins, while North Oldham is on a three-game streak of away wins: one of those streaks is about to end. The Oldham County Colonels will welcome the North Oldham Mustangs at 7:30 p.m. on Thursday. The two teams are sauntering into the matchup backed by comfortable wins in their prior games.
Last Thursday, Oldham County got the win against Providence by a conclusive 3-0.
Oldham County's not only won, but also showed off some consistency: keeping Providence between 20 and 21 points across their sets. The match finished with set scores of 25-21, 25-21, 25-20.
Meanwhile, everything went North Oldham's way against Holy Cross on Tuesday as North Oldham made off with a 3-0 win.
North Oldham walked away with the victory (but they looked especially good in the third set). The final score came out to 25-19, 25-21, 25-11.
Campbell Floyd went supernova for North Oldham, getting 30 digs. Floyd is on a roll when it comes to digs, as she's now had 16 or more in the last three games she's played dating back to last season.
North Oldham was lethal from the service line and finished the game with ten aces.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now served at least five aces in four consecutive matches.
Oldham County has been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four matchups, which somehow still isn't as good as their 13-4 record this season. As for North Oldham, their win bumped their record up to 16-6.
